Corneal Chronicles: Corneal ulcers, often a consequence of trauma or foreign object contact, can prompt increased tear production and eye discharge. 6.The Balinese is a long-haired breed of domestic cat with Siamese-style point coloration and sapphire-blue eyes. The Balinese is also known as the purebred long-haired Siamese since it originated as a natural mutation of that breed and hence is essentially the same cat but with a medium-length silky coat and a distinctively plumed tail.. The cross-eye trait in Siamese cats is primarily attributed to a genetic condition called strabismus. This condition causes the misalignment of the eyes, leading to a cross-eyed appearance. The gene is responsible for strabismus is linked to the coat colour patterns in Siamese cats. The same gene that controls the distribution of …The Red Point Ragdoll Cat. Cats classified as Traditional or Thai Siamese haven't been bred to reduce the cross-eyed gene. Although many Siamese cats aren't cross-eyed, historically the trait was considered normal for the breed. Today, Siamese with and without crossed eyes exist. The body is long, athletic, muscular and tubular. Legs are long and slender with small, oval feet. Hind legs are longer than the front legs. The tail is long, thin and whip-like.

Flame points are one color variation of the Siamese breed. While each individual cat has its own personality, the color of a cat does not have an impact on personality traits. Kitten's mother is Calico.Dec 13, 2023 · Cross-eyed cats, also known as strabismus, have a unique visual condition that sets them apart from their feline counterparts. Unlike normal cats, their eyes are misaligned and do not focus on the same point.
